We proceed northwest and encounter several buildings, such as the Hearst Building, the Time Warner Center, to arrive at Lincoln Center, home of the acclaimed Metropolitan Opera House and the Julliard School of Music where we make a stop Continuing on the west side of Central Park we encounter the Dakota Building inhabited throughout its history by such illustrious tenants as Rudolf Nureyev, Leonard Bernstein, and John Lennon who was assassinated in front of the building's entrance. We stop for a visit to Strawberry Fields in Central Park.
A little further on we encounter the Museum of Natural History. We go from the West to the East Side crossing the Park we head south along Fifth Avenue; we stop without getting off to admire Frank Lloyd Wright's jewel, the Guggenheim Museum; we are in the area of museums called "Museum Mile" and will encounter several (National Design, Metropolitan Museum, Frick Collection). We continue to 42nd Street where we find the New York Public Library; stop in front of New York's first skyscraper, the Flatiron Building, photo of the majestic Empire State Building behind us. We continue to Greenwich Village, home of artists and birthplace of the Beat Generation.
